64 Paraguayans to travel to Taiwan with scholarships for higher education

Asunción, Agencia IP.- The Embassy of the Republic of China (Taiwan) in Paraguay has announced the selection of 64 Paraguayans who have been awarded scholarships to pursue undergraduate, postgraduate, and Mandarin language studies at educational institutions in Taiwan.

This achievement was made possible thanks to the cooperation between the Government of Taiwan and Paraguayan government bodies such as the Ministry of Economy and Finance (MEF), through the National Scholarship Program «Carlos Antonio López» (BECAL), and the National Institute of Public Administration of Paraguay (INAPP), as well as the Ministry of Education and Sciences (MEC), through the Directorate of Higher Education Scholarships.

The scholarships awarded in this edition are distributed as follows:

  • 50 MOFA scholarships for undergraduate studies
  • 7 ICDF scholarships for postgraduate (master’s) programs
  • 7 HUAYU scholarships for Mandarin Chinese language studies

Since 1991, Taiwan has granted a total of 820 scholarships to Paraguayan students and public officials, strengthening the historical ties of cooperation, friendship, and mutual development between the two countries.

This new group of scholarship recipients is preparing to embark on a unique academic and cultural experience at Taiwanese universities, gaining access to high-level education in various fields of knowledge.
